The SPP24N60CFDHKSA1 belongs to the category of power MOSFETs and is designed for use in various electronic applications. This component is known for its high efficiency, low on-resistance, and fast switching characteristics. It is typically packaged in a TO-220 package and is available in varying quantities to suit different production needs.
The SPP24N60CFDHKSA1 features a standard TO-220 pin configuration with three pins: gate, drain, and source.
The SPP24N60CFDHKSA1 operates based on the principles of field-effect transistors, utilizing the control of electric fields to modulate the conductivity of the device. When a suitable voltage is applied to the gate terminal, the MOSFET allows current to flow between the drain and source terminals.
The SPP24N60CFDHKSA1 finds extensive use in various applications including: - Switching power supplies - Motor control - Inverters - LED lighting - Audio amplifiers

Q: What is the maximum drain-source voltage rating of SPP24N60CFDHKSA1? A: The maximum drain-source voltage rating of SPP24N60CFDHKSA1 is 600V.
Q: What is the continuous drain current rating of SPP24N60CFDHKSA1? A: The continuous drain current rating of SPP24N60CFDHKSA1 is 24A.
Q: Can SPP24N60CFDHKSA1 be used in high-frequency switching applications? A: Yes, SPP24N60CFDHKSA1 is suitable for high-frequency switching applications.
Q: What is the typical on-resistance of SPP24N60CFDHKSA1? A: The typical on-resistance of SPP24N60CFDHKSA1 is 0.19 ohms.
Q: Is SPP24N60CFDHKSA1 suitable for use in power supplies? A: Yes, SPP24N60CFDHKSA1 is commonly used in power supply applications.
Q: Does SPP24N60CFDHKSA1 require a heat sink for thermal management? A: It is recommended to use a heat sink for efficient thermal management when using SPP24N60CFDHKSA1 in high-power applications.
Q: What type of packaging is SPP24N60CFDHKSA1 available in? A: SPP24N60CFDHKSA1 is available in TO-220 packaging.
Q: Can SPP24N60CFDHKSA1 be used in motor control applications? A: Yes, SPP24N60CFDHKSA1 is suitable for motor control and drive applications.
Q: What is the operating temperature range of SPP24N60CFDHKSA1? A: The operating temperature range of SPP24N60CFDHKSA1 is typically -55°C to 150°C.
